This opportunity entails being responsible for providing guidance and direction in the area of geotechnical engineering, especially as it applies to the railroad and transit industry. In particular, responsibilities in this position are associated with railway geotechnics, asset maintenance management, and railway data analysis. This position supports the technical aspect of project development and delivery including proposal development, scope implementation and change management.
What You’ll Do:
- Performs independent technical reviews, makes recommendations, and provides technical guidance as requested on complex or unusual engineering projects. Provides direction to resolve technical issues as requested.
- Provides technical expertise and advice to project leadership, and mentoring/support to production staff.
- Assists in marketing responsibilities, including proposal generation on complex or unusual engineering projects within discipline.
- Coordinates technical aspects with client counterpart and teaming partners at local leadership level for work within the discipline on complex or unusual engineering projects.
- Develops and advises on technical consistency within discipline across processes and projects. Ensures same standard and practices are being applied.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
What You’ll Need:
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ering and 10 years of relevant experience, or
- Master’s degree in Engineering and 9 year of relevant experience, or
- PhD in Engineering and 8 years of relevant experience
What You’ll Bring:
- Understands the railroad and transit environment.
- Uses persuasion to communicate solutions while understanding the project goals and interests of the stakeholders.
- Demonstrates a vision for complex and unique challenges, especially as they relate to the complex interrelationship of disparate railway-derived data.
- Understands engineering principles behind the design code requirements.
- Promotes knowledge within the industry through authoring technical papers, technical presentations, and serving on technical committees.
- Understands, supports, and influences multiple concurrent projects.
- Discovers opportunities for technical improvements across the firm and collaborates with peers to share ideas.
- Serves as a subject matter expert in their field.
What We Prefer:
- Master’s degree in Engineering
- 15 years relevant experience
- Professional Engineer (PE) certification
